Sympatisant: Suche Event (Download)

Guten Abend allerseits,

ich habe eine Seite, auf der durch Abschicken eines Formulares ein
Download gestartet wird. Es handelt sich um ein Pdf-File, welches
im Header bereits als solches deklariert wurde. Folglich oeffnet
sich der "Save File as"-Dialog. Hier hat der Benutzer ja bekanntlich
die Auswahl zwischen "OK" und "Cancel".
Kann ich mich mittels Javascript an eben diesen Event haengen?
Hintergrund ist der, dass ich, sobald der Benutzer auf den Submit-
Button geklickt hat, einen Status-/Ladebalken anzeige (da der Request
einige Sekunden dauern kann), und diesen - nach Bestaetigen o. Abbrechen
des Downloads - wieder entfernen moechte.

Kann mir einer Hinweise geben?
Danke sehr.

MfG,
Sympatisant

--
"Non dura iubeantur, non prohibeantur inpura."
  1. Hi,

    mir ist das submit event des <form> tags bekannt, allerdings keins, was beim klicken von "ok" des Download Dialogs feuert.

    Evtl. reicht dir ja auch das Einblenden eines Wartedialogs für eine bestimmte Zeit via setTimeout.

    Gruß!

    1. Hallo,

      mir ist das submit event des <form> tags bekannt, [..]

      Evtl. reicht dir ja auch das Einblenden eines Wartedialogs
      für eine bestimmte Zeit via setTimeout.

      Naja, das ist mir ein bisschen zu ungenau. Ich weiss ja nicht,
      _wie_ lange das Generieren der Datei dauert.

      Aber danke dennoch.

      MfG,
      Sympatisant

      --
      "Non dura iubeantur, non prohibeantur inpura."
      1. n'abend,

        Evtl. reicht dir ja auch das Einblenden eines Wartedialogs
        für eine bestimmte Zeit via setTimeout.
        Naja, das ist mir ein bisschen zu ungenau. Ich weiss ja nicht,
        _wie_ lange das Generieren der Datei dauert.

        Vielleicht musst du einfach ein wenig umdenken.

        Du könntest zum Beispiel eine Seite anzeigen, die den Generierungsfortschritt anzeigt und nach Beendigung der Generierung auf die (zwischengespeicherte) PDF Datei weiterleitet. Das würde halt bedeuten, dass du das zu generierende Dokument irgendwo zwischenspeichern musst - aber das sollte ja kein großes Problem sein.

        weiterhin schönen abend...

        --
        #selfhtml hat ein Forum?
        sh:( fo:# ch:# rl:| br:> n4:& ie:{ mo:} va:) de:] zu:} fl:( ss:? ls:[ js:|
  2. ich habe eine Seite, auf der durch Abschicken eines Formulares ein
    Download gestartet wird. Es handelt sich um ein Pdf-File, welches
    im Header bereits als solches deklariert wurde. Folglich oeffnet
    sich der "Save File as"-Dialog. Hier hat der Benutzer ja bekanntlich
    die Auswahl zwischen "OK" und "Cancel".
    Kann ich mich mittels Javascript an eben diesen Event haengen?

    Nein.

    Struppi.